В каком расширении сохраняется книга Microsoft Excel: полный обзор форматов

Стандартная книга Microsoft Excel по умолчанию сохраняется в файле с расширением .xlsx, если вы используете версию программы 2007 года или новее. Этот формат базируется на технологии Open XML и обеспечивает сжатие данных, что уменьшает итоговый размер документа по сравнению с бинарными предшественниками. При попытке сохранить файл в более старых версиях офисного пакета система может предложить выбрать совместимый тип, однако для современной работы оптимальным является именно XML-структура.

Понимание разницы между доступными расширениями критически важно для корректного обмена данными между сотрудниками и заказчиками. Если вы отправите файл в формате .xlsm, содержащий макросы, получателю может потребоваться дополнительно разрешить выполнение скриптов, тогда как .xlsx автоматически блокирует любой программный код ради безопасности. Неправильный выбор расширения при сохранении может привести к потере функциональности или невозможности открыть документ на устройствах коллег.

В операционной системе Windows полное имя файла будет выглядеть как Отчет.xlsx, где точка разделяет имя и расширение. Расширение файла определяет, какая программа будет использована для его открытия по умолчанию, и какие функции будут доступны пользователю после запуска. Игнорирование типа файла при экспорте данных часто становится причиной технических ошибок, когда таблица открывается в режиме совместимости с ограниченным набором инструментов.

Эволюция форматов хранения данных Excel

История табличного процессора делится на две большие эпохи: до и после внедрения формата Open XML. До выхода версии 2007 года основным стандартом являлся бинарный формат .xls, который доминировал на рынке более двух десятилетий. Этот формат был проприетарным, закрытым и менее эффективным с точки зрения занимаемого места на диске, но он обеспечивал полную совместимость со всеми legacy-системами того времени.

С выходом Office 2007 компания Microsoft внедрила новую архитектуру хранения, где книга Excel сохраняется в файле с расширением .xlsx. Буква "x" в конце названия указывает на XML-основу документа. Внутри такой файл представляет собой ZIP-архив, содержащий множество XML-файлов, которые описывают структуру данных, стили, настройки и содержимое ячеек. Это позволило существенно повысить надежность восстановления данных при повреждении файла.

⚠️ Внимание: Файлы, созданные в новых версиях Excel (.xlsx), по умолчанию не открываются в версиях 2003 года и старше без установки специальных пакетов совместимости.

Различие между форматами заключается не только в расширении, но и в лимитах. Старый формат .xls ограничен 65 536 строками и 256 столбцами, тогда как современные форматы, такие как .xlsx и .xlsb, поддерживают более миллиона строк и 16 тысяч столбцов. Переход на новые стандарты хранения стал необходимостью для обработки больших массивов данных (Big Data) внутри офисных приложений.

📊 Какой формат Excel вы используете чаще всего?
.xlsx (Стандартный)
.xls (Старый формат)
.csv (Текстовый)
.xlsm (С макросами)

Основные типы файлов и их расширения

При выборе команды "Сохранить как" пользователь сталкивается с длинным списком вариантов, каждый из которых имеет свои технические особенности. Наиболее распространенным является .xlsx, который представляет собой стандартную книгу без поддержки макросов. Если в вашем документе присутствуют скрипты VBA, сохранение в этом формате приведет к их удалению, о чем система выдаст предупреждение.

Для работы с программируемыми таблицами используется расширение .xlsm. Этот формат идентичен стандартному, за исключением того, что он разрешает хранение и выполнение макросов. Безопасность в данном случае строится на том, что файл с макросами не может иметь расширение .xlsx, что визуально сигнализирует пользоватluatелю о потенциальном риске при открытии документа из непроверенного источника.

Существует также бинарный формат .xlsb (Excel Binary Workbook). Он часто используется для очень больших файлов, так как читается и сохраняется быстрее, чем XML-аналоги, и занимает меньше места. Однако этот формат менее совместим со сторонними программами и онлайн-сервисами, которые могут не уметь корректно парсить бинарную структуру.

  • 📊 .xlsx — стандартная книга Excel без макросов (основной формат).
  • ⚙️ .xlsm — книга Excel с поддержкой макросов (требуется для VBA).
  • 🗄️ .xlsb — двоичная книга Excel (для ускорения работы с большими данными).
  • 📜 .xls — книга Excel 97-2003 (устаревший бинарный формат).

Отдельного внимания заслуживает формат .xltx, который представляет собой шаблон Excel. При открытии такого файла программа не редактирует исходник, а создает его копию с именем "Книга1", сохраняя оригинал неизменным. Это удобно для создания типовых отчетов, счетов-фактур или бланков, которые должны заполняться регулярно.

Текстовые форматы и обмен данными

Часто возникает необходимость передать данные в систему, которая не поддерживает сложные табличные структуры, или импортировать информацию из базы данных. В таких случаях книга Microsoft Excel сохраняется в файле с расширением .csv (Comma Separated Values). Это простой текстовый файл, где значения ячеек разделены запятыми, а строки — символами перевода строки.

Главной особенностью CSV является потеря форматирования. При сохранении в этот формат исчезают все формулы, графики, макросы, условное форматирование и даже формулы вычислений — остаются только итоговые значения. Если в ячейке была формула =A1+B1, в CSV-файл запишется только результат вычисления, например, число 15.

⚠️ Внимание: При сохранении в формате CSV сохраняется только активный лист книги. Все остальные листы будут безвозвратно утеряны, если предварительно не сохранить их в отдельные файлы.

Существует также формат .txt (текстовый файл с разделителями), который позволяет выбрать другой символ разделения, например, табуляцию или точку с запятой. Это актуально для регионов, где запятая используется как десятичный разделитель, что может вызвать конфликты при импорте числовых данных в другие системы.

Сравнительная таблица характеристик форматов

Для быстрого выбора подходящего типа файла необходимо понимать ключевые различия между ними. Ниже приведена таблица, демонстрирующая основные параметры популярных расширений, используемых в экосистеме электронных таблиц.

Расширение Полное название Поддержка макросов Совместимость
.xlsx Книга Excel Нет Excel 2007+
.xlsm Книга Excel с макросами Да Excel 2007+
.xls Книга Excel 97-2003 Да (VBA) Все версии
.csv Текст с разделителями Нет Любой текстовый редактор
.xlsb Двоичная книга Excel Да Excel 2007+

Выбор между .xlsx и .xlsb часто становится предметом дискуссий среди аналитиков данных. Бинарный формат может ускорить открытие файла на 30-50% при объеме данных в сотни мегабайт. Однако, если файл планируется передавать внешним контрагентам, лучше использовать стандартный XML-формат во избежание вопросов о безопасности.

Формат .xls следует использовать только в том случае, если получатель файла гарантированно работает на компьютере с Excel 2003 или старше. В современных условиях это встречается редко, но в государственных учреждениях и на промышленных предприятиях со старым ПО такое требование все еще актуально.

Настройки сохранения по умолчанию

Пользователи могут изменить формат, в котором книга Microsoft Excel сохраняется по умолчанию, чтобы не выбирать его каждый раз вручную. Это особенно удобно для организаций, работающих со специфическими требованиями к совместимости. Для изменения настроек необходимо перейти в меню Файл -> Параметры -> Сохранение.

В разделе "Сохранять файлы в этом формате" можно выбрать нужный тип из выпадающего списка. Если вы работаете в среде, где все используют Excel 2003, имеет смысл установить галочку напротив .xls. Однако для большинства современных офисов оптимальным выбором остается .xlsx.

☑️ Чек-лист перед сохранением файла

Выполнено: 0 / 4

Также в настройках можно активировать функцию автовосстановления и указать интервал сохранения. Это критически важная опция, которая позволяет создать резервную копию файла в случае внезапного отключения электроэнергии или сбоя программы. Путь к папке автовосстановления можно изменить, если стандартное расположение диска переполнено.

Проблемы совместимости и конвертация

При работе с файлами разных поколений часто возникают проблемы с отображением функций. Если вы сохраните книгу в формате .xlsx, но используете функции, появившиеся только в Excel 2019 или Office 365 (например, ВПР с новым синтаксисом или функцию ТЕКСТ_ПОСЛЕ), пользователи старых версий увидят ошибку #ИМЯ? или #ЗНАЧ!.

Режим совместимости, который включается автоматически при работе с файлами .xls, отключает многие современные возможности. В этом режиме недоступны новые типы диаграмм, расширенные возможности форматирования и некоторые логические функции. Индикатор режима совместимости обычно отображается в заголовке окна программы.

⚠️ Внимание: Конвертация файла из нового формата в старый (.xlsx в .xls) может привести к необратимой потере данных и искажению визуального оформления таблицы.

Для проверки файла на наличие проблем с совместимостью используйте встроенную функцию "Проверка совместимости". Она находится в меню Файл -> Сведения -> Проверка на наличие проблем -> Проверить совместимость. Отчет укажет, какие именно элементы не будут работать в предыдущих версиях Excel.

Скрытые возможности проверки совместимости

В отчете о совместимости можно увидеть не только ошибки, но и предупреждения о возможной потере качества графики или точности вычислений при конвертации в старые форматы.

FAQ: Часто задаваемые вопросы

Можно ли открыть файл .xlsx в Excel 2003?

Без установки дополнительного пакета совместимости (Microsoft Office Compatibility Pack) — нет. Программа просто не распознает формат файла. С установленным пакетом открытие возможно, но некоторые новые функции могут не работать или отображаться некорректно.

Почему файл Excel весит так много, хотя данных немного?

Размер файла может раздуваться из-за наличия множества скрытых объектов, кэша сводных таблиц, истории изменений или использования форматирования во всей строке/столбце, а не только в заполненных ячейках. Также формат .xls всегда будет весить больше, чем .xlsx при одинаковом содержимом.

В чем разница между .xlsm и .xlam?

.xlsm — это обычная книга с макросами, которая открывается как рабочий документ. .xlam — это надстройка Excel, которая не открывает видимого окна, а добавляет свои функции и макросы в пул доступных инструментов программы для использования в других файлах.

Как сохранить книгу Excel в формате PDF?

Для этого нужно выбрать Файл -> Экспорт (или Сохранить как) и выбрать тип файла PDF. Это позволит зафиксировать внешний вид таблицы для печати или отправки клиентам, запретив редактирование данных.

Безопасно ли открывать файлы с расширением .xlsm?

Файлы с макросами потенциально опасны, так как могут содержать вредоносный код. Открывайте .xlsm только из доверенных источников. Excel по умолчанию блокирует выполнение макросов в файлах, скачанных из интернета, до подтверждения пользователем.